Abstract

This invention discloses a data processing method, apparatus, electronic device, and storage medium. The method includes: upon receiving a transaction request, determining a requester identifier corresponding to the transaction request; determining a request verification result for verifying the transaction request based on a standard message format corresponding to the requester identifier; if the request verification result indicates the request is valid, processing the transaction data corresponding to the transaction request based on preset verification rules to determine a data verification result; and based on the data verification result, determining a target processing method for processing the transaction request, and obtaining an execution result corresponding to the transaction request based on the target processing method. This solves the problems of low transaction efficiency and poor accuracy caused by manual transaction review in the prior art, achieving the effect of improving transaction security while simultaneously improving transaction convenience and accuracy.

Technical Field

[0001] This invention relates to the field of computer processing technology, and in particular to a data processing method, apparatus, electronic device, and storage medium. Background Technology

[0002] With the development of the social economy, in order to better meet the transaction needs of merchants or institutions, it is usually necessary to manage the transaction information submitted by users with transaction needs.

[0003] Currently, transaction management typically involves manually verifying the transaction information submitted by the user on the corresponding trading institution's website or in person, obtaining the transaction certificate, and then manually processing the transaction in the settlement system. This method is not only inefficient but also prone to errors due to operator mistakes. Summary of the Invention

[0030] Example 1

[0031] Figure 1 This is a flowchart of a data processing method according to Embodiment 1 of the present invention. This embodiment is applicable to transaction processing. The method can be executed by a data processing device, which can be implemented in hardware and / or software and can be configured in a computing device. Figure 1 As shown, the method includes:

[0032] S110. Upon receiving a transaction request, determine the requester identifier corresponding to the transaction request.

[0033] A transaction request can be understood as a program or code that requests a transaction to be conducted. It can be a request for the transfer of rights or interests, or a request for the transfer of rights or interests. The requester identifier can be used to identify the uniqueness of the transaction requester, who can be an individual, enterprise, institution, department, etc.

[0034] In this embodiment, when a transaction request is received, the transaction request can be parsed to obtain the requester identifier of the transaction requester carried on the transaction request.

[0035] S120. Based on the standard message format corresponding to the requester's identifier, determine the request verification result for verifying the transaction request.

[0036] It should be noted that, to enhance risk control, each transaction requester can pre-set and transmit its own defined specifications to the system, such as a standard message format for standardizing messages. For example, this can be in XML, JSON, or a message format that includes pre-defined message type, message version, message length, and message entity information. This allows the system to verify transaction requests sent by the requester based on the standard message format.

[0037] In this embodiment, after determining the requester identifier, the standard message format corresponding to the requester identifier can be retrieved, and the transaction request can be verified according to the standard message format, such as verifying whether the transaction request message matches the standard message format, to obtain the request verification result, and to determine whether the transaction request is a normal transaction based on the request verification result.

[0038] Optionally, the method for determining the request verification result for verifying a transaction request based on the standard message format corresponding to the requester identifier can be as follows: based on a pre-determined mapping relationship, determine the standard message format corresponding to the requester identifier; if the request message format corresponding to the transaction request is inconsistent with the standard message format, then determine the request verification result as invalid; if the request message format corresponding to the transaction request is consistent with the standard message format, then determine the request verification result as valid.

[0039] The mapping relationship includes the requester's identifier and the corresponding standard message format.

[0040] In practical applications, mapping techniques can be used to determine the standard message format associated with the requester's identifier. This standard message format is then compared with the request message format of the transaction request. If the two message formats match, the transaction request is considered normal, and the request verification result is valid. If the message formats do not match, the transaction request is considered abnormal, and the request verification result is invalid. For example, if the request message format of transaction request A is XML, and the corresponding standard message format is JSON, they are inconsistent, and the request verification result for transaction request A is invalid. When the request verification result is determined to be invalid, the transaction request can be marked as a restricted transaction, the transaction can be terminated, and feedback information regarding the restricted transaction can be generated and sent back to the transaction requester so that the transaction requester is promptly informed of the specific details of the transaction.

[0041] For example, newly added enterprises or financial institutions can distinguish messages (i.e., transaction request messages) by using specific points in their message content. Upon receiving a transaction request message, it is compared with a pre-defined standard message format. If the format is different, it indicates that the message is not a normal transaction and the transaction process can be terminated directly. If the format is the same, it indicates that the message is a normal transaction and the request verification result is that the request is valid.

[0042] S130. If the verification result of the request is that the request is valid, then the transaction data corresponding to the transaction request is processed based on the preset verification rules to determine the data verification result.

[0043] The preset verification rules may include, but are not limited to, transaction validity rules, transaction security rules, and user validity rules. Transaction validity rules can refer to rules used to verify whether a transaction is valid, such as serial number verification. Transaction security rules can refer to rules used to verify whether a transaction is secure, such as transaction value verification and transaction frequency verification. User validity rules can refer to rules used to verify whether the transaction requester is valid, such as user permission verification. Optionally, the preset verification rules may also include rules defined by the user according to business needs, such as value verification and date verification. Transaction data includes at least one of the following: transaction identifier, transaction type, transaction value, transaction date, requester identifier, processor identifier, and processing requirement information. The transaction identifier can be a transaction number, such as a serial number.

[0044] In this embodiment, if the request verification result indicates that the request is valid, the transaction data corresponding to the transaction request can be further verified using preset verification rules to obtain a data verification result. For example, this includes verifying whether the transaction frequency is within a preset controllable frequency range, verifying whether the transaction data sent by the requester can be processed, and verifying whether the order number in the transaction data is unique, etc. This ensures that the transaction request continues to be processed when the data verification result indicates successful verification, thus guaranteeing transaction security.

[0045] To facilitate data processing, transaction data corresponding to transaction requests can be processed based on preset verification rules. Before determining the data verification result, the transaction request can be parsed to obtain the transaction data corresponding to the transaction request; the transaction data can then be converted into a recognizable data stream.

[0046] Specifically, before determining the data verification result corresponding to the transaction request, the transaction request can be parsed first to obtain transaction data associated with the transaction request, such as transaction identifier, transaction type, transaction value, transaction date, requester identifier, processor identifier, and processing requirement information. Then, the transaction data can be converted into system-recognizable data as a recognizable data stream. At this time, the recognizable data stream is a unified, valid, and usable data stream within the system, and subsequent verification operations can be performed based on the recognizable data stream to determine the data verification result.

[0047] In this embodiment, the transaction data corresponding to the transaction request can be processed sequentially or in parallel based on the various verification rules in the preset verification rules to determine the data verification result. That is to say, different preset verification rules result in different ways of determining the data verification result.

[0048] Optionally, the preset verification rule is the transaction validity rule. Based on the preset verification rule, the transaction data corresponding to the transaction request is processed to determine the data verification result. The implementation method can be: check the transaction record database corresponding to the requester's identifier; if the transaction record database contains the request record corresponding to the transaction data, the data verification result is determined to be successful; if the transaction record database does not contain the request record, the data verification result is determined to be unsuccessful.

[0049] The transaction record database is used to store record information for transaction requests.

[0050] In this embodiment, after determining that the verification result of the transaction request is valid, a query message corresponding to the transaction requester is generated to query the transaction record database corresponding to the requester's identifier. This database is the transaction record database of the transaction requester. If the transaction record database contains a request record corresponding to the transaction data, the transaction is considered valid, and the data verification result is determined to be successful. If the transaction record database does not contain the request record, i.e., the transaction cannot be found, the data verification result is determined to be unsuccessful. When the data verification result is determined to be unsuccessful, the transaction request can be marked as a restricted transaction, the transaction can be terminated, and feedback information on the restricted transaction can be generated and sent back to the transaction requester so that the transaction requester can be informed of the specific details of the transaction in a timely manner.

[0051] For example, based on different transaction information formats, key information (i.e., transaction data) is extracted, the requester identifier of the transaction requester is determined, and a transaction query message corresponding to the requester identifier is assembled. The validity of the transaction request is checked. If the query cannot be found, it is determined that it is not a valid transaction, and only the transaction information is recorded without executing subsequent transaction operations.

[0052] Optionally, the preset verification rule is a user validity rule, and the transaction data includes a transaction identifier and a processor identifier. The transaction data corresponding to the transaction request is processed based on the preset verification rule to determine the data verification result. This can be achieved by: determining the number of identifiers in the identifier generation library that match the transaction identifier; if the number of identifiers is a preset number, determining whether the permission record library contains the requester identifier and the processor identifier; if they are contained, the data verification result is determined to be successful; if they are not contained, the data verification result is determined to be unsuccessful.

[0053] The identifier generation library stores historical transaction identifiers generated during historical request transactions, which can be represented by transaction numbers. The default quantity is 1. The permission record library stores the identifiers of the requester and the processor who have usage permissions.

[0054] In this embodiment, the transaction identifier in the transaction data can be compared with historical transaction identifiers in the identifier generation library to count the number of identifiers in the identifier generation library that match the transaction identifier. If the identifier count is not 1, it indicates that the transaction is not unique and may be a duplicate transaction. In this case, the transaction request can be marked as a restricted transaction, and the transaction process can be terminated. If the identifier count is 1, it indicates the uniqueness of the transaction. It can then be checked whether the permission record library contains the requester identifier and processor identifier from the transaction data. If they are contained, it indicates that the user is valid, the transaction is allowed, and the data verification result is determined to be successful. If they are not contained, it cannot be matched with a user with permissions in the system, the transaction is temporarily not allowed, and the data verification result is determined to be failed. When the data verification result is determined to be failed, a manual review process can be introduced to manually confirm the user's identity.

[0055] For example, it can be confirmed whether the processed transaction data (i.e., the identifiable data stream) is a duplicate transaction. If a duplicate transaction is found, the transaction process ends. If it is not a duplicate transaction, a user validity check is performed. If no user can be found in the system, the process proceeds to manual review to verify the user information. If the user information cannot be verified, the transaction fails.

[0056] Optionally, the preset verification rule is a transaction security rule. Based on the preset verification rule, the transaction data corresponding to the transaction request is processed to determine the data verification result. The implementation method can be as follows: determine the transaction attributes corresponding to the transaction data. The transaction attributes include at least one of transaction frequency, cumulative transaction data, and continuous non-transaction duration. If the transaction attributes meet the transaction security rule, the data verification result is determined to be successful. If at least one of the transaction attributes does not meet the transaction security rule, the data verification result is determined to be unsuccessful.

[0057] The transaction security rules include rules such as a transaction frequency lower than a preset transaction frequency, cumulative transaction data lower than a preset cumulative transaction value, and continuous non-transaction duration lower than a preset non-transaction duration.

[0058] In this embodiment, transaction attributes can be calculated from transaction data. For example, the current transaction information and the historical transaction information of the transaction requester within a unit time period (such as one month or three months) can be accumulated to obtain the cumulative transaction data as a transaction attribute. Alternatively, the interval between two transactions can be determined based on the transaction request time and the transaction time of the last transaction by the transaction requester, serving as the continuous non-transaction duration, i.e., a transaction attribute. Transaction attributes can be verified using transaction security rules, such as determining whether the transaction frequency is less than a preset transaction frequency, whether the cumulative transaction data is less than a preset cumulative transaction value, or whether the continuous non-transaction duration is less than a preset non-transaction duration. If all are true, the transaction attribute is considered to meet the transaction security rules, and the data verification result is determined to be successful. If not, at least one of the transaction attributes is considered to fail to meet the transaction security rules, and the data verification result is determined to be unsuccessful. This achieves risk monitoring of transaction data and improves transaction security.

[0059] For example, after confirming the data verification result as successful based on user validity rules, transaction security rule verification can be performed. If the security fails, a manual review stage can be initiated. If the manual review fails, the transaction is confirmed as failed, i.e., the verification fails.

[0060] In this embodiment, when the data verification result is verification failure, the process includes: sending the transaction data to the manual review module; receiving the review result from the manual review module based on the transaction data; and if the review result is successful, adjusting the data verification result to successful.

[0061] In this embodiment, when the data verification result is determined to be verification failure, the transaction data can be sent to the manual review module for manual review of the security of the transaction data. If the data is secure, the review result is passed; otherwise, it is rejected. After manual review, the review result can be fed back to the system. After receiving the review result from the manual review module, the system can determine whether the review result is passed. If it is, the data verification result is adjusted to successful; otherwise, the transaction request is marked as a restricted transaction, the transaction is terminated, and restricted transaction feedback information is generated and sent back to the transaction requester so that the transaction requester can be informed of the specific details of the transaction in a timely manner.

[0062] S140. Based on the data verification results, determine the target processing method for processing the transaction request, so as to obtain the execution result corresponding to the transaction request based on the target processing method.

[0063] Specifically, if the data verification result is a failure, the target processing method for the transaction request could be to mark the transaction request as a restricted transaction, terminate the transaction, and generate restricted transaction feedback information to be sent back to the transaction requester. If the data verification result is a successful verification, the transaction operation is automatically performed, such as transferring the rights to the transaction requester's account or transferring the rights to the transaction processor's account. It should be noted that after automatically completing the transaction operation, a scheduled task can also periodically request transaction vouchers from the corresponding transaction processor to prove the authenticity and validity of the transaction.

[0065] Example 2

[0066] As an optional embodiment of the above embodiments, Figure 2 This is a schematic diagram of a data processing method provided in Embodiment 3 of the present invention. For details, please refer to the following specific content.

[0067] See Figure 3Upon receiving a transaction request, the system differentiates between different formats (such as XML or JSON) and determines whether the request message format matches the standard message format. If the formats differ, it indicates an invalid transaction, and the transaction process is terminated, resulting in a transaction failure. If the formats match, the system parses the transaction data based on the request message format to extract key information. It then assembles a transaction query message corresponding to the requester and checks the transaction's validity. If the query is unsuccessful, the transaction is deemed invalid, and only the transaction information is recorded without further action, resulting in a transaction failure. If the query is successful, the transaction is considered valid, and the information is organized into a unified and usable data stream (identifiable data stream) for subsequent operations. Further, based on the organized and identifiable data stream, the system checks if the transaction is a duplicate. If it is, the transaction process terminates. If it is not a duplicate, the system checks user validity. If a user cannot be identified within the system, the transaction is considered invalid and enters a manual review process for confirmation of the user information. If the user information cannot be confirmed, the transaction fails. If a user is identified within the system, the transaction is considered valid. Furthermore, after confirming user information, risk control rules are verified to determine transaction security. If risk control fails, a manual review stage is initiated; if the manual review also fails, the transaction fails. Once risk control is successful, the transaction is executed automatically. After automatic execution, a scheduled task can periodically request transaction vouchers from the corresponding transaction processor to prove the authenticity and validity of the transaction.

[0068] It should be noted that if new enterprises or financial institutions join the system, the standard message formats of each party can be saved. For example, see [link to example]. Figure 3 When a transaction requester (e.g., Requester A, Requester B, Requester C, Requester D, Requester E) requests a transaction, the system parses the message content (i.e., the transaction request) by distinguishing specific points in the message content. After parsing, the transaction request is formatted into a unified information format and then undergoes a series of risk control checks. If the checks pass, the transaction is automatically executed in the system. If the checks fail, manual review is conducted, and the transaction is automatically executed if the review is successful. The entire transaction process is processed programmatically. Each transaction message is strictly controlled according to the rules. If risk control or other checks fail, a manual review process is triggered. Different processing procedures are applied based on the reason for the failure, significantly reducing labor costs, improving the accuracy and convenience of transaction processing, effectively verifying transaction risk, and enhancing risk control.
